Code P13D7 Volkswagen Description

The P13D7 diagnostic trouble code for Volkswagen indicates a sensor for the internal pressure of cylinder 3 is experiencing an electrical malfunction. This sensor is crucial in monitoring the pressure within the combustion chamber of the third cylinder. When a malfunction occurs, it can lead to improper fuel-air mixture ratios, timing issues, and potentially affect the engine's performance and efficiency.

Common Causes of P13D7 Volkswagen

  1. Faulty sensor for internal pressure of cylinder 3
  2. Wiring or connector issues related to the sensor
  3. ECM malfunction
  4. Engine mechanical problems affecting cylinder 3
  5. Poor electrical connections or corrosion

Symptoms of P13D7 Volkswagen

  1. Check engine light illuminated on the dashboard
  2. Reduced engine performance
  3. Rough idling or stalling
  4. Engine misfires
  5. Decreased fuel efficiency

How to Fix P13D7 Volkswagen

  1. Begin by conducting a thorough inspection of the sensor, wiring, and connectors for any visible damage or wear.
  2. Test the sensor using a multimeter to check for proper resistance and voltage readings.
  3. If the sensor is found to be faulty, replace it with a new, OEM-quality sensor.
  4. Clear the diagnostic trouble codes from the ECM's memory using a scan tool.
  5. Test drive the vehicle to ensure the issue has been resolved and the check engine light does not reappear.

Cost to Fix P13D7 Volkswagen

The typical repair costs for addressing a P13D7 code can vary depending on the specific cause of the issue. In general, replacing the sensor for internal pressure of cylinder 3 and addressing any associated wiring or connector problems can range from $200 to $500 in parts and labor. It is advisable to consult with a trusted auto repair shop for a more accurate estimate based on your vehicle's make and model, as well as the prevailing labor rates in your area.
